What affects the price

Plumbing repairs vary based on a few key factors. The primary driver is the complexity of the fix; reaching a pipe behind a wall or under a foundation takes more time than swapping a faucet. We also look at the parts needed, the specific materials involved, and whether the issue is a simple blockage or a deep line repair. Accessibility plays a major role, as does the urgency of the situation.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

What are the common signs of a leaky toilet that a plumber can fix?

Common signs of a leaky toilet that a plumber can fix include a constantly running toilet, water pooling around the base, or a weak flush. These issues often stem from worn-out flappers, faulty fill valves, or a compromised wax seal. A professional can quickly diagnose and repair the source to prevent water waste.

What's involved when a plumber installs a new toilet in Long Beach?

When a plumber installs a new toilet in Long Beach, they'll begin by disconnecting and removing the old unit. They'll then prepare the drain and water supply lines, ensuring a proper seal. The new toilet is carefully set, secured, and connected, followed by thorough testing for leaks and functionality.

What should I do about a plumbing clogged toilet?

If you have a plumbing clogged toilet, the first step is to try a plunger, ensuring a good seal. If that doesn't work, avoid flushing it again to prevent overflow. It's often best to call a licensed plumber who has the specialized tools to clear stubborn clogs safely and efficiently.
